As of 2024, the per capita market size for men's and boys' nightshirts or pyjamas made of synthetic fibres in Italy is forecasted to be $0.66, following from an actual value of $0.65 in 2023. From 2024 to 2028, the value is expected to grow steadily by $0.01 each year, reaching $0.70 by 2028. This represents a consistent annual growth rate of approximately 1.5% over the five-year period.
Future trends to watch for include:
- The potential impact of sustainability initiatives on synthetic fibre production.
- The influence of consumer preference shifts towards comfort and affordability in nightwear.
- Macroeconomic factors affecting disposable income and purchasing decisions in Italy.
